摘要
In this work CdS nanocrystals (NCs) have been synthesized with thermochemical method using two different capping agent molecules: thioglycolic acid (TGA) and thioglycerol (TG). XRD analysis demonstrated hexagonal crystal phase for both samples. Band gap of NCs was obtained 3.13eV and 3.2eV for TG capped and TGA capped NCs respectively. The nonlinear refractive index and nonlinear absorption coefficient were obtained in order of 10(-8) (cm(2)/W) and 10(-3) (cm/W) for both samples, respectively. The linear absorption coefficient was obtained about 2.63cm(-1) and 1.14cm(-1) for TG capped and TGA capped NCs, respectively.
